Zaghouan is an agricultural town of Roman origin (Ziqua) built at the foot of Jebel Zaghouan (1,295 m) and rich in spring-fed fountains. It is a charming little medina clinging to the slopes of the wooded hill. Its religious architecture reflects deep Andalusian influences, as a community of Andalusian refugees settled there in the 17th century.
